Fiona knitted Mabel’s Sister in Viola Organic Merino DK, in the colours Magnolia and Garden Ghost. This yarn is expertly dyed by Emily Foden, of Viola, and has the most wonderful subtle shading and beautiful speckles. It’s super soft and drapes like a dream, and the base is completely organic!

We have the kit in two colour ways; Magnolia with Garden Ghost, as the sample shows, and Silver Birch with Bronte, for a more muted version of our new cardigan. The kits include a copy of the printed pattern, as well as a special ‘Loop in Edinburghtote bag, that we had made especially for EYF!

The pattern is designed in six different sizes. Our model Laeticia is wearing a size 3, with 14 inches (or 35.5cm) positive ease. It’s very oversized on her, but this cardigan is intended to be worn with 8-14 inches of positive ease, to produce and cosy and comfy garment.
